Stansbury also owns MSU's record for consecutive 20-win seasons with four from 2001 to 2005 and again from 2006 to 2010. Prior to Stansbury taking over as head coach, MSU had just seven postseason tournament appearances and won at least 20 games just seven times in the school's previous 86 years of basketball competition. Of the Top 30 most attended games in MSU history, 26 came during Stansbury's run as head coach including all of the Top 10. The Bulldogs won the SEC tournament in 2002 and 2009, the overall SEC championship in 2004 and dominated the league's Western Division during Stansbury's tenure, winning the side in 2003, 2004, 2007, 2008 and 2010. In Stansburys sixth season at the helm, WKU posted a 19-13 record, winning nine of its last 10 regular season conference games to earn a bye in the C-USA Tournament. In Stansbury's second season in 2017-18, the Hilltoppers finished 27-11 their most wins since the 2007-08 season and the most wins in the state of Kentucky that year and advanced to the semifinals of the NIT for the first time since 1954. Originally from the tiny town of Wolf Creek in Meade County, Kentucky, Stansbury says his early years were simple and he and his friends focused on just a few things. Richard Lee Stansbury (born December 23, 1959), is an American college basketball and the current head coach of the Western Kentucky Hilltoppers basketball team. He was previously the head coach at Mississippi State. He was hired as the WKU head coach on March 28, 2016. [2] [3] He is a member of the Campbellsville University Athletics Hall of Fame. Stansbury also brings to The Hill a national reputation of success as evidenced by his 2004 SEC Associated Press Coach of the Year, finalist for National Coach of the Year, and District 17 NABC Coach of the Year awards. The Hilltoppers have 11 wins over Power Five teams since the start of the 2017-18 season, including a 3-4 record against ranked Power Five teams.
